7 Ejemplos This shirtEsta camisa That girlEsa chica Those shoesEsos zapatos These booksEstos libros That employee (over there)Aquel empleado

8 Vamos a practicar Translate to Spanish: Ex: This shirt is green. Esta camisa es verde. 1.That book is blue 2.This skirt is pink 3.Those dresses are red 4.These jackets are white 5.Those (over there) shoes are expensive

9 El euro The euro is the official currency of 19 countries in the European Union- including Spain Right now € 1 = $1.10 The U.S. dollar is the official currency of the U.S., its territories, and Ecuador- fewer countries than the euro!

11 En Espana In Spain, big stores are very uncommon. It’s uncommon to come across a supermarket like we have in America- usually you have to go to a few little markets to get different groceries like produce, meat, bread, etc. There aren’t big clothing stores like Walmart, Target, Macy’s- except for one called Corte Ingles
